Prescott is applauded for its art and entertainment with such cultural attractions as Sharlot Hall Museum and Fort Whipple Museum. This historical city has something for everyone including its mountains, breweries and sights like Yavapai County Courthouse and Whiskey Row.

What will the weather in Prescott be like during my visit?
The warmest months in Prescott are usually July and June, with an average temperature of 24°C. January and December are the chilliest months, when the average temperature is 5°C. The rainiest months are July and August.
